How to use this

A work problem often has more than one cause. You may like the work but not the hours. You may want a bigger role without leading a team. Astrofluence keeps the work you want apart from the way you want to do it. What you already know about your days shows which part needs care.

Start with four questions, kept apart. What work do you want to do? How should the working day run? What would fair pay look like? What needs care right now? A new job may fix one and leave the rest. Write down what you want to keep, not just what you want to change.

Example

Say you are thinking of leaving a design job. Do you want other work, fewer last-minute requests, or more say in what gets built? Those are three different problems. Naming one gives your read a sharper question than asking which job is perfect.
